What Is ‘Jurassic World Rebirth’ About?
Rebirth is the seventh installment of the overall Jurassic Park franchise and the fourth Jurassic World movie. It serves as a standalone sequel to Jurassic World Dominion.
Rebirth follows Zora Bennet, an ex-CIA operative leading a team to explore the island research facility which served as the site for the original Jurassic Park.
“Their mission is to secure genetic material from dinosaurs whose DNA can provide life-saving benefits to mankind,” the IMDb summary reads. “As the top-secret expedition becomes more and more risky, they soon make a sinister, shocking discovery that’s been hidden from the world for decades.”

Who Is the Cast of ‘Jurassic World Rebirth’?
Jurassic World Rebirth boasts a star-studded cast, featuring The Avengers actress Scarlett Johansson as film lead Zora Bennett, Wicked star Jonathan Bailey as Dr. Henry Loomis, A Simple Favor actor Rupert Friend as Martin Krebs and Spider Man: Across the Spiderverse’s Mahershala Ali as Duncan Kincaid.
Other cast members include Ed Skrein as Atwater, Luna Blaise, who plays Teresa Delgado, and David Iacono as Xavier Dobbs.
Who Is the Director of ‘Jurassic World Rebirth?’
While Colin Trevorrow (Safety Not Guaranteed) directed two of the franchise’s previous installments, Jurassic World and Jurassic World Dominion, Gareth Edwards (Rogue One: A Star Wars Story) took over as director of Rebirth.
“Jurassic Park is a horror film in the witness protection program,” Gareth told Vanity Fair in an February 2025 interview. “Most people don’t think of it like that. We all went to see it as kids. But I was scared s–tless, to be honest, when I was at the cinema watching the T. rex attack. It’s one of the most well-directed scenes in cinema history, so the bar’s really high to come on board and try and do this.”

Is There a New Dinosaur in ‘Jurassic World Rebirth?’
Rebirth is set to introduce a formidable new mutant dinosaur reportedly known as the D-Rex that will give Zora Bennett a run for her money.
“When you make a creature, you get a big, massive pot and you pour in your favorite monsters from other films and books,” Gareth explained to Vanity Fair of the inspiration behind the new dino. “Some Rancor went in there, some H.R. Giger went in there, a little T. rex went in there…”
‘Jurassic World Rebirth’ Trailer
The trailer for Rebirth combines a heavy dose of nostalgia for the original Jurassic Park trilogy with a fresh cast, updated dinosaurs and an intriguing plot. It opens with an introduction of Zora, who learns she is being hired by a company to seek out the ingredients to make a cure for heart disease.
“This would be a medical breakthrough that could save countless lives,” Martin Krebs (Rupert Friend) says in a voiceover amid shots of Zora and her team exploring the island. “It comes from the largest dinosaurs on the planet. Fortunately for us, all these species exist in one isolated place.”
No matter how skilled their team is, it quickly becomes clear it’s going to be a tough fight to survive as Zora and the rest of the group can be seen running, climbing and falling off of cliffs in pursuit of dinosaurs deemed “too dangerous” for the original park.
When Is ‘Jurassic World Rebirth’ Coming Out?
Rebirth will hit theaters on July 2, 2025.
